Understanding the 100-150 TPH Stone Crusher Plant
The 100-150 TPH stone crusher plant is a significant piece of machinery widely utilized in the construction and mining industries. TPH, meaning "tons per hour," reflects the plant's capacity to crush stone. This particular configuration is well-suited for medium-scale production needs, offering an efficient balance between capacity and energy use.
Features and Components
1. Primary Crusher
- Jaw Crusher: A jaw crusher is the heart of a 100-150 TPH stone crusher plant. Its robust construction and ability to handle large chunks of raw materials make it indispensable.
2. Secondary Crushers
- Impact Crusher: Ideal for producing cubic-shaped stones, making it easier for further processing.
- Cone Crusher: Offers precision crushing with high productivity and longevity.
3. Vibrating Screen
- Ensures the separation of crushed materials into different size fractions, enhancing the efficiency of subsequent steps.
4. Conveyors
- Durable belts that facilitate the smooth transfer of materials from one crusher to another, ensuring a streamlined process.

Best Practices for Maintenance
To ensure the 100-150 TPH stone crusher plant operates at peak efficiency, regular maintenance is crucial. Here are some tips:
- Routine Inspections: Regularly check all components for signs of wear and tear. This includes the primary and secondary crushers, screens, and conveyors.
- Lubrication: Adequate lubrication of moving parts can significantly extend the plant’s operational life.
- Cleanliness: Keeping the plant clean prevents the buildup of dust and debris, which can affect performance.
- Training: Ensure that operators are well-trained to handle the equipment and recognize potential issues early.
